Understanding What Subscription Management Software Does

At its core, subscription management software automates the process of managing recurring payments and customer subscriptions. It can handle billing cycles, renewals, cancellations, and upgrades, while also providing analytics and reporting. This reduces manual workload and ensures customers are billed accurately and on time.

Key Features to Look For

When evaluating subscription management software, look for features such as flexible billing options, multiple payment gateways, customer self-service portals, and robust reporting capabilities. Integration with your existing CRM, accounting tools, and marketing platforms is also important for seamless operations.

Assessing Scalability and Customization

Your business needs will evolve, so choose software that can scale with you. Look for solutions that offer customizable pricing models and can accommodate growth in subscriber numbers. The ability to tailor workflows and automate specific tasks will help you maintain efficiency as your business expands.

Considering User Experience and Support

A user-friendly interface makes it easier for your team to adopt the software quickly. Additionally, reliable customer support from the software provider is crucial for troubleshooting issues or getting assistance with setup. Check reviews and ask about support options before making a commitment.

Budgeting and Pricing Models

Subscription management software varies widely in cost, often based on features, number of users, or transaction volume. Determine your budget upfront and compare pricing models. Some providers offer tiered plans, while others charge per subscriber or transaction. Choose a solution that offers good value without compromising essential features.
